  2. Mar 22, 2024 · An inscription in the Aramaic language—"James, son of Joseph, brother of Jesus"—appears on an empty ossuary, a limestone burial box for bones. Andre Lemaire said it’s "very probable" the writing refers to Jesus of Nazareth. He dates the ossuary to A.D. 63, just three decades after the crucifixion.

  3. Apr 6, 2024 · James, brother of Jesus, was an unbeliever during Jesus’ ministry. Because Jesus appeared to him (1 Cor. 15:3-7), he became a believer. And not just any believer. He became leader of the church in Jerusalem. His martyrdom is attested by Non-Christian sources. Further Reading: “The Case for the Resurrection.” Habermas and Licona. 2004.
